4.11.4.3. Selecting Parameters for RS–422 Port
The parameters for the RS–422 port are initially set as follows:
Figure 4-35 Checking Current Parameters for RS–422
・ Data Bits: 8 bits
・ Stop Bits: 1 bit
・ Parity: Odd parity
・ Bit Rate: 4800 baud
